Electronic Ovulation Test

The work of the electronic test for ovulation is based on the definition of increasing the level of luteinizing hormone in the body of a woman. This occurs approximately 24 to 36 hours before the release of the egg from the follicle. With the help of a reusable electronic test for ovulation, it is possible to establish directly 2 days of the menstrual cycle, in which the probability of conceiving a child is greatest.

How to use the digital ovulation date test?

When using the electronic test for ovulation, a woman should strictly follow the instructions that go along with the device itself.

So, according to her it is necessary to take one test strip (only 7 pieces) and place in the holder. Only after this test itself can be placed under the urine stream for 1-3 seconds.

The results can be analyzed after 3 minutes after the test.

If the display shows a smiley face, it means that the concentration of the hormone has reached the required level, which in turn speaks of ovulation. In cases where the test display has an empty circle, this means that the ovule from the follicle has not yet emerged.

It is necessary to conduct such studies at the same time all the time. At the same time, there are no instructions regarding the specific time of day, as in the case of a pregnancy test.
